Red Dirt Ultra 50k (they also offered a 100k and 100 mile)

This race is in Provencal, LA just outside of Natchitoches. It got hot today. The high hit at least 80. I heard a couple people DNF'd from dehydration. This race was rough. It had sand, pine needles, mud puddles, shin deep water crossing, and a stretch of uphill dirt road that felt like it went on forever. Most of the trail is on ATV and horse trails. I stepped in one spot of mud and lost a shoe. Luckily someone helped me dig it out. I don't know how I got my muddy sock back in that shoe, but I did and I was off again. One of the guys I ran with for a while, fell in a puddle after he sunk knee deep in mud and caught himself with his hands and had mud up to his elbows. The group I was in also went off course and ended up going about an extra mile after it was all said and one. Even after all that, everyone stayed in good spirits. There was a full spread food at the end - rice, red beans, gumbo, and chili (both meat and vegan versions of all).

The aid stations were decent, but they weren't all manned by experienced trail runners, but it was fine. They were still helpful. Everyone was friendly and helpful. It was fun, but I think I would do the Loup Garou race again before this one. The after party was better at Red Dirt, but I liked the trail better at Loup Garou.

Hopefully you experienced guys can tell me some things I can do better or what I'm doing wrong.

After long runs (20+ miles), I feel sick. Not nauseous, but almost like I have a fever with chills and inability to just feel comfortable. I am eating breakfast of some sort before and drinking water. During my run, I'm drinking water, electrolytes, and fueling. I feel like my fueling during races/runs is pretty good. After my run/race, I'm usually not hungry, but I try to keep drinking water and drinking something with calories, and I will also make myself eat as much as I can right after, even though it's usually not a full meal. I'll eat a full meal a few hours later. It's usually a little after that when I start to get chills and I have trouble getting comfortable enough to get a good nights' sleep. I don't really feel like it's a water issue, because I usually have to pee multiple times after the run. It's like when I stop running my body is like ok don't need this anymore.

Any ideas how to minimize this?
